Complications of Body Contouring Surgery in Postbariatric Patients: A Systematic Review and Meta-Analysis.

2021 
Obesity is a major global health problem. With an increasing number of bariatric surgeries, the need for body-contouring procedures has grown. These procedures are associated with multiple complications because of various patient characteristics and risk factors. In this study, we performed a systematic literature review of all the complications of postbariatric body contouring surgeries, as well as a meta-analysis to estimate the effects of body mass index (BMI) and the weight of the tissue resected during body contouring on the development of complications. We conducted a literature search of the PubMed and Cochrane databases in September 2020, using the MeSH terms plastic surgery, weight loss, and complications. Studies were included if they involved more than 35 postbariatric patients and reported postoperative complication rates and types. In total, 561 articles were initially identified, and 25 studies were included after the final review. The overall weighted rate of postbariatric body contouring surgical complications in all studies was 31.5%. The most frequent complication from all regions of body contouring was seroma (weighted rate 12.7–13.9%). Regarding risk factors, analysis indicated that a BMI < 30 kg/m2 and low mean weight of resected tissue were associated with fewer complications. Body contouring procedures are relatively safe. Although complications after contouring are common, most either resolve spontaneously or require minimal intervention. In body contouring after bariatric surgery, there is a 37% increased risk of developing complications if the BMI is ≥ 30 kg/ $$m^{2}$$ before body contouring.
